So when you open one node from a pair it resets and respawns the "oldest" pair. So if youre looking for maps and theyre only giving you the one you dont want you go around the nodes(this works for either map - if you want the soloable gagana and theyre only spawning the group gazelle then you respawn, if you want a gazelle to do with friends or to sell and theyre only spawning gagana then you respawn). You dont have to harvest anything, just opening the node is enough. Check both sets from node a, then check one or both from node b. When you open one of the node c pair the node a's will respawn - this means new chance at better gathering conditions, new chance at hidden materials, new chance at rare materials(like maps as long as you havent harvested one in the last 18 hours). Then opening one from a will reset b, your next b will reset c, and it goes on and on until you find what you want. Respawning ephemeral nodes requires opening one node from two seperate pairs(so a+b a+c or b+c). And as others have said, the ephemeral mats on their own arent really anything special. They primarily exist for aetherial reduction. Reduction(or buying from someone else who does) is the only source for a few crafting mats that are used in a ton of recipes.
